Top Manga Featuring Strong Female Leads
Here’s a list of some prominent manga that showcase strong female leads making an impact in their respective narratives.
1. "Attack on Titan" by Hajime Isayama
The character Mikasa Ackerman stands out as one of the strongest female leads in manga. Her combat skills and unwavering dedication to her friends set her apart, making her an essential part of humanity's fight against Titans. Throughout the series, she embodies strength, loyalty, and courage.
2. "Fullmetal Alchemist" by Hiromu Arakawa
Riza Hawkeye is another remarkable character who serves as a skilled sharpshooter and a loyal ally to the Elric brothers. Her depth and commitment to her duties highlight her complexity within a male-dominated military world, making her an integral part of the story's success.
3. "Fruits Basket" by Natsuki Takaya
Tohru Honda exemplifies kindness and emotional strength as she navigates the challenges presented by the Sohma family curse. Her gentle nature and ability to bring people together make her a compelling strong female lead, showing how emotional resilience can create profound change.
4. "The Promised Neverland" by Kaiu Shirai
Emma is a standout character known for her strategic mind and unwavering determination to save her friends from their grim fate. Her intelligence and resourcefulness illustrate how strength extends beyond physical abilities.

Characteristics of Strong Female Leads
Understanding what makes these characters compelling can enhance our appreciation of the stories they inhabit.
Complexity and Depth
Strong female leads are often crafted with intricate backgrounds and detailed personalities. Readers engage more deeply when characters face moral dilemmas, internal conflicts, or relational challenges. For example, Riza Hawkeye’s loyalty is constantly tested, creating tension that enriches her character arc.
Growth and Development
Their journeys frequently involve significant growth. For instance, Emma evolves from an innocent girl into a formidable strategist fighting against odds. This development showcases how challenges can lead to empowerment.
Emotional Strength
Characters like Tohru Honda demonstrate that emotional strength can be just as impactful as physical strength. This facet adds layers to their representation, allowing readers to connect with their vulnerabilities.
